Understanding the Importance of Spanish Pronunciation Practice

Pronunciation is a foundational element of language learning. Without accurate pronunciation, even the most extensive vocabulary or grammar knowledge can fall short in effective communication. In Spanish, pronunciation plays a crucial role because many words differ only slightly in sound but have entirely different meanings. For example, “pero” (but) and “perro” (dog) are distinguished primarily by the rolling “r” sound, which learners often find challenging.

Stress and Intonation

Spanish words have specific stress rules, and incorrect stress can change word meanings. For example, “papa” (potato) and “papá” (dad) differ in stress placement. Intonation—the rise and fall of the voice—also conveys emotion, question forms, and emphasis.

2. Phonetic Training

Studying the International Phonetic Alphabet (IPA) symbols for Spanish can help learners understand exactly how sounds are produced. Some apps and online resources provide phonetic breakdowns, which can be combined with audio examples to enhance Spanish pronunciation practice.
